Masakazu Adachi is a scholar working on Molecular Biology, Immunology and Hematology. According to data from OpenAlex, Masakazu Adachi has authored 109 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Molecular Biology, 28 papers in Immunology and 13 papers in Hematology. Recurrent topics in Masakazu Adachi’s work include Glycosylation and Glycoproteins Research (11 papers), Immune Cell Function and Interaction (6 papers) and Cell Adhesion Molecules Research (6 papers). Masakazu Adachi is often cited by papers focused on Glycosylation and Glycoproteins Research (11 papers), Immune Cell Function and Interaction (6 papers) and Cell Adhesion Molecules Research (6 papers). Masakazu Adachi collaborates with scholars based in Japan, United States and Australia. Masakazu Adachi's co-authors include Abby R. Saniabadi, Katsuya Hiraishi, Katsuyuki Nakajima, Honami Naora, Takamitsu Nakano, Hiroto Naora, Nobuhito Kashiwagi, Akira Tanaka, Toshimitsu SAITO and Sen‐itiroh Hakomori and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Experimental Medicine and The Journal of Cell Biology.
